Abstract
The invention discloses a camellia drying device which comprises a box body. A filter steel wire screen is fixedly arranged in the box body through a pair of vibrators. A pair of heating bars is arranged on the inner wall of the box body. A temperature controller is further arranged on the top end face of the box body. A temperature control probe is arranged on the temperature controller and extends into the box body. The camellia drying device is good in drying effect, short in drying cycle and capable of having an effect sterilization effect, and the health degree of the drink containing camellia is high.

Detailed description of the invention
The technological means realized to make the present invention, creation characteristic, reaching object and effect is easy to understand, below in conjunction with concrete diagram, setting forth the present invention further.
As shown in Figure 1-2, the drying unit of a kind of camellia, it comprises casing 1, filtrate steel bolting silk 2 is provided with in casing 1, filtrate steel bolting silk 2 is installed in casing 1 inside by a pair electromagnetic shaker 3, and casing 1 inwall is provided with a pair heating rod 4, and casing 1 top end face is also provided with temperature controller 8, temperature controller 8 is provided with temperature probe 9, temperature probe 9 stretches in casing 1, and structure is simple, easy to use, financial cost is low, and environmental protection degree is high; Good drying effect, the cycle of drying is short, has bactericidal effect simultaneously, effectively can improve the health degree that camellia is drunk.
The drying unit of a kind of camellia it also comprise the charging aperture 10 on top and the discharging opening 11 of bottom, for material turnover easy to use.
Discharging opening 11 is arranged between two electromagnetic shakers 3, and the tealeaves be convenient to through drying and processing falls under electromagnetic shaker 3 acts on.
Be positioned on the casing 1 above heating rod 4 and be also provided with overflow pipe 5, the two ends of overflow pipe 5 are respectively water inlet 6 and delivery port 7, are convenient to control the temperature in casing 1, prevent tealeaves and are dried to occurring burning phenomenon.
Evenly be processed with some openings 12 at filtrate steel bolting silk 2 central part, facilitate gas to circulate, improve drying efficiency.
